Spectrum Brands Australia Pty Ltd and Spectrum Brands New Zealand Limited

WARRANTY AGAINST DEFECTS

In this warranty:

Australian Consumer Law

 means the Australian consumer law set out in Schedule 2 to the 

Competition and Consumer Act 2010;

CGA

 means the New Zealand Consumer Guarantees Act 1993;

Goods

 means the product or equipment which was accompanied by this warranty and 

purchased in Australia or New Zealand, as the case may be;

Manufacturer, We

 or 

us

 means:

1.  for Goods purchased in Australia, Spectrum Brands Australia Pty Ltd  

ACN, 007 070 573; or

2.  for Goods purchased in New Zealand, Spectrum Brands New Zealand Limited, 

as the case may be, contact details as set out at the end of this warranty;

Supplier

 means the authorised distributor or retailer of the Goods that sold you the Goods

in Australia or in New Zealand; and

You

 means you, the original end-user purchaser of the Goods.

1.  Our goods come with guarantees that cannot be excluded under the Australian Consumer 

Law, or the CGA. You are entitled to a replacement or refund for a major failure and 
compensation for any other reasonably foreseeable loss or damage. You are also entitled 
to have the goods repaired or replaced if the goods fail to be of acceptable quality and the 
failure does not amount to a major failure.

2.  The benefits provided by this Warranty are in addition to all other rights and remedies in 

respect of the Goods which the consumer has under either the Australian Consumer Law 
or the CGA. The original purchaser of the Goods is provided with the following Warranty 
subject to the Warranty Conditions:

3.  We warrant the Goods for all parts defective in workmanship or materials for the period of 

two (2) years from the date of purchase

 (Warranty Period).

 If the Goods prove defective 

within the Warranty Period by reason of improper workmanship or material, we may, at our 
own discretion, repair or replace the Goods without charge.

Warranty Conditions

4.  The Goods must be used in accordance with the manufacturer’s instructions. This Warranty 

does not apply should the defect in or failure of the Goods be attributable to misuse, abuse, 
accident or non-observance of manufacturer’s instructions on the part of the user. As far as 
the law permits, the manufacturer does not accept liability for any direct or consequential 
loss, damage or other expense caused by or arising out of any failure to use the Goods in 
accordance with the manufacturer’s instructions.

5.  Exhaustible components (such as shaver heads, cutters and foils) of the Goods are included 

under this Warranty only where there is a defect in workmanship or materials used.

6.  The warranty granted under clause 3 is limited to repair or replacement only.

7.  Any parts of the Goods replaced during repairs or any product replaced remain the property 

of the manufacturer. In the event of the Goods being replaced during the Warranty Period, 
the warranty on the replacement Goods will expire on the same date as for the Warranty 
Period on the original Goods which are replaced.
